Biography: Ronnie O'Sullivan, OBE (born 5 December 1975) is an English professional snooker player from Chigwell, Essex. Widely recognised as one of the most talented and accomplished players in the history of the sport, he holds the record for the most ranking titles in professional snooker. As a seven-time world champion, a seven-time Masters champion and a eight-time UK champion, he has won a record 23 Triple Crown titles. He has been ranked world number one on multiple occasions and was awarded an OBE in 2016. From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
